コピペ1〜とにかく書いてみようじゃないか


135:SPALM:ID:QVhW4UrgO
今日知ったのですが初心者なもので全くと言っていい程意味が分かりません

誰か詳しく教えてくれるか、初心者用の解説ページ等を教えて下さいませんか?

136:非通知さん@アプリ起動中 :ID:hjalDfyk0
今どこまでできるんだ

137:非通知さん@アプリ起動中 :ID:aU0D5aq10
ttp://game.p-wiki.jp/mobilejava/(このwikiは見れません)

Wikiを見れば参考になるかな・・・
プログラミング自体初めて?
JavaScript?だけでも組んだ事があれば話が早いけど・・・

138:SPLAM:ID:gSfLmlssO
まだ全然なんです…
初めての挑戦です…

139:SPLAM:ID:gSfLmlssO
間違えてまだ途中だったのに書いてしまったw
要するにまだ何も分かりません
普通の説明ページ見ても分かりませんでした…

不甲斐ないです…

140:非通知さん@アプリ起動中:ID:yoTjo4a7O
とにかく書いてみて慣れろ。…と初心者に毛が生えた程度の自分がいってみる。

text("テスト中",10,10,0)
input()

↑まずこの二行をそのまま書き込んでみるべし。

書き込んで保存したら、RUNを押す。

すると、画面の左上に
テスト中
と表示されるはず。

textは文字を表示させる命令文な。

上手くいったら、今度はtext("テスト中",10,10,0)の""の中を好きな文字にかえてみて。""の中の文が表示されるから。

text("テスト中",10,10,0)の10,10,の所の数字をいじると、表示される文字の場所が変わる。
ただし240以上にすると画面の外に行っちゃうから、0〜240の範囲で。

text("テスト中",10,10,0)の最後の0はそのままにしとくべし。
俺にもよくわからんがいじる必要はほとんどない。

input()は…、とりあえずここでは「何かボタンが押されるまで一時停止しろ」っていう命令文。
(ほんとはかなり違うけど)

SPALMは(というか大抵の言語は)最後まで命令文を実行すると自動的に終わってしまうのでinput()等で止めとかないと一瞬で終わってしまう。
試しに

text("一番目",10,10,0)
input()
text("二番目",10,40,0)
input()
text("三番目",10,70,0)
input()
と書いてみるとinput()の効果が分かりやすいかも。
まだまだ初めの一歩にすらなってないけど、ちょびっとでもオモシレーと思ってくれると幸い。



参考
text
input
scan